Dominique Alderweireld, known as "Dodo la Saumure", was a French pimp and brothel owner who became a public figure through the Carlton de Lille affair involving Dominique Strauss-Kahn. Born in Annœullin in the Nord department, he was raised by Jesuits and admitted to a difficult childhood and some burglaries in his youth.

He began his career as a real estate agent for Félix Houphouët-Boigny before running a network of brothels in Belgium, operating under the guise of massage parlors and bars. At their peak in 2011 he ran sixteen establishments across towns including Tournai, Froyennes, Warneton, and Mouscron.

In 2011 he was detained and later convicted of running houses of prostitution and procuring, receiving a five-year suspended sentence and confiscation of 2.77 million euros in proceeds. He was also indicted in the Carlton de Lille affair, where he supplied prostitutes for parties attended by Dominique Strauss-Kahn and other notables.

He died of heart failure in Tournai, Belgium, at the age of 77.
